Markets
Checking over the latest weather forecasts is usually where traders turn first Monday, followed by the usual USDA reports. USDA's weekly grain inspections report is out at 10 a.m. CDT followed by USDA's monthly cold storage report at 2 p.m. and the crop progress report at 3 p.m. CDT. Any trade news that comes up will also be noticed.
Weather
Hot and dry conditions will cover most primary crop areas Monday. This combination will lead to further drying and crop stress. Southeastern U.S. areas will have periods of tropical rain as Tropical Storm Marco in the Gulf of Mexico moves closer to the mainland.
